About This Item
Paris: Editions Bordas, 1965, 1965. Hardcover pictorial boards. Good.. Printed in France. 576 pages. One good ding in front cover, some rubbing at top of spine. Binding loosening but not cracked or broken. Well illustrated with black & white photos and portraits and color plates, featuring paintings by French artists. Authors include Mme de Stael, Chateaubriand, Alfred de Musset, Victor Hugo, Sand, Balzac, Stendhal, and Baudelaire.
